There is a significant gap in the cost of living between these two cities. Delmita is 18.8% cheaper than Chireno. With a cost index of 50 vs 59, the difference would have a meaningful impact on a household's monthly budget. Someone relocating from Delmita to Chireno should plan for substantially higher expenses across most categories.

On the housing front, median rent in Chireno is $665/month compared to $325/month in Delmita — a 105% difference. Interestingly, home values tell a different story: while Delmita has cheaper rent, Chireno actually has lower median home values ($74,000 vs $85,000).

Median household income in Chireno is $61,705 compared to $29,808 in Delmita (+107%). While Chireno is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Chireno spend roughly 12.9% of their income on rent, less than the 13.1% in Delmita.
